Output 63e1419985f61f99b2d8e7c6720cc56a50f1cd7da11225ede874bcb6b71dac98:14

value
6700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e38186a2dcb974860fc4408057e15a099ecce9d8 OP_EQUAL
address
ADBDDZ6K8ye6zTZLMdLLeTwubEXqhcSPbw
transaction
63e1419985f61f99b2d8e7c6720cc56a50f1cd7da11225ede874bcb6b71dac98